Lava flows coiled like snail shells have been found for the first time on Mars. Arizona State University graduate student Andrew Ryan spotted the spirals while studying possible interactions of lava flows and floods of water in the Elysium volcanic province of Mars. A Researcher has spotted lava flows shaped like coils of rope near the equator of Mars.
The infrared vision of NASA's Spitzer Space Telescope has revealed that the Sombrero galaxy named after its appearance in visible light to a wide-brimmed hat is in fact two galaxies in one. According to the NASA, this is a large elliptical galaxy (blue-green) with a thin disk galaxy (partly seen in red) embedded within. Previous visible-light images led astronomers to believe the Sombrero was simply a regular flat disk galaxy.

Enterprise is scheduled to arrive in the city Friday, riding on top of a modified jumbo jet. NASA just announced that on Friday, April 27, space shuttle Enterprise will be "piggybacked" on a 747 Shuttle Carrier Aircraft from Washington Dulles International Airport to New York's JFK. Its trip was to include low-altitude flyovers over parts of the city and landmarks including the Statue of Liberty and the Intrepid Sea, Air and Space Museum on Manhattan's west side.
Scientists have long debated how farming expanded across Europe. Thousands of years ago, farming spread across Europe and replaced the hunter-gatherer lifestyle of early inhabitants. his undated picture made available by Johan Norderang shows a skeleton in Ajvide, Sweden of a person in his 20s dated to over 4000 years ago. Now a study of ancient DNA says that trend was driven by farmers moving from place to place.
